All DBPR Inspector Observations

12 full violation description(s) documented by the inspector during this visit.

High Priority 3

#8High Priority41-05-4

High Priority – Pesticide/insecticide labeled for household use only present in establishment. Observed raid spray bottle next to fire s. Operator removed spray bottle during inspection. **Corrected On-Site**

Corrected On-Site
#9High Priority08A-05-6

High Priority – Raw animal food stored over/not properly separated from ready-to-eat food. Observed raw steak stored above cheese inside standing reach in cooler, operator stored properly during inspection. **Corrected On-Site**

Corrected On-Site
#10High Priority03B-01-6

High Priority – Time/temperature control for safety food, other than whole meat roast, hot held at less than 135 degrees Fahrenheit. Observed cooked pork (98F – Hot Holding) next to stove, as per operator less than 2 hours. Operator moved food to reach in cooler. **Corrective Action Taken**

Corrective Action Taken

Intermediate 2

#11Intermediate02C-02-5

Intermediate – Ready-to-eat, time/temperature control for safety food prepared onsite and held more than 24 hours not properly date marked. Observed cooked pork not date marked on reach in cooler, as per operator over 24 hours. Operator dated during inspection. **Corrected On-Site**

Corrected On-Site
#12Intermediate41-17-4

Intermediate – Spray bottle containing toxic substance not labeled. Observed degreaser spray bottle not identified with common name. **Corrected On-Site**

Corrected On-Site

Basic 7

#1Basic06-09-1

Basic – Commercially processed reduced oxygen packaged fish bearing a label indicating that it is to remain frozen until time of use no longer frozen and not removed from reduced oxygen package. Observed raw mahi filets still on ROP packages on standing unit. Operator cut packages during inspection. **Corrected On-Site**

Corrected On-Site
#2Basic35A-03-4

Basic – Dead roaches on premises. Observed 1 dead roach under flat grill.

#3Basic40-06-5

Basic – Employee personal items stored in or above a food preparation area, food, clean equipment and utensils, or single-service items. Observed personal bag stored on top of food container, operator removed during inspection. **Corrected On-Site**

Corrected On-Site
#4Basic36-01-4

Basic – Floor not cleaned when the least amount of food is exposed.

#5Basic22-08-4

Basic – Interior of oven/microwave has accumulation of black substance/grease/food debris.

#6Basic23-03-4

Basic – Nonfood-contact surface soiled with grease, food debris, dirt, slime or dust. Observed grease accumulation on top of the stove. Also observed soiled gaskets on reach in cooler across 3 compartment sink. Also observed soiled gaskets on reach in coolers.

#7Basic22-16-4

Basic – Reach-in cooler interior/shelves have accumulation of soil residues. Observed on 2 units.
